Overall Satisfaction with Amazon Aurora
- Primarily use it in our core payments platform given that we need strong ACID properties but we’re looking to transition to dynamodb soon given that dynamodb also has transaction semantics
- It is our de facto database for starting any new microservice
- Cost effective relational database
- High availability in multiple regions
- Fully managed
- I/O costs are incurred
- Not fully MySQL compatible especially if you’re using something very specific to mysql
- Might hit the upper limit on max number of connections
- Fully managed letting engineering teams self manage also lessening the burden on platform/devops
- Automated backups and ability to restore snasphots of data
- Cost effective
